Speed Test: Is ExpressVPN worth the extra cost over IPVanish?
To measure raw throughput, we ran Speedtest.net against a 1 Gbps fiber line across 5 weeks of daily benchmarking from our team office, cycling through local, mid-haul, and trans-Pacific endpoints at peak and off-peak hours. On local servers, ExpressVPN pulled ahead with a clear lead at 938 Mbps over its proprietary Lightway protocol, while IPVanish tracked behind at 837 Mbps on WireGuard.
That ~100 Mbps gap is the difference between a 100 GB Steam library landing in roughly 15 minutes versus a noticeably longer wait.
The picture flips on long-haul routes. Pushing traffic to New York and Tokyo, IPVanish edged the test at 779 Mbps against ExpressVPN‘s 773 Mbps.
Close enough to call a draw in real use, but a quiet win for IPVanish’s backbone routing. Latency tells the same story: IPVanish landed at 12 ms versus 14 ms for ExpressVPN, a 2 ms edge that won’t register on a Netflix stream but matters frame-by-frame in competitive shooters.

BVI Privacy vs US Jurisdiction: The Battle for Your Data
Jurisdiction matters more here than for most pair-ups. ExpressVPN sits in the British Virgin Islands, outside the 5/9/14 Eyes alliances, and has commissioned 23 third-party audits since 2018 from KPMG, PwC, Cure53, and F-Secure: the highest cadence in the industry. IPVanish headquarters in New York, USA: a founding 5 Eyes member: and has published two audits to date (Leviathan Security Group, Schellman Compliance LLC).
Context worth knowing: in 2016, under previous owner Highwinds/StackPath, IPVanish handed user logs to the FBI in a CSAM case despite advertising a no-logs policy. Under Ziff Davis ownership since 2019, the new no-logs policy has been independently verified: but 23 audits versus 2 is a trust gap that doesn’t close overnight. Both providers run RAM-only servers; ExpressVPN additionally added post-quantum encryption in 2023.

Compatibility: From Routers to Refrigerators
ExpressVPN caps you at 8 simultaneous device connections, which is generous for a solo user or couple but tight once a smart TV, console, router, and a few phones start fighting for slots. IPVanish sidesteps the math entirely with unlimited simultaneous connections.
One account covers the whole household, the IoT shelf, and a spare travel laptop without ever logging anything out. Both ship native apps across iOS, Android, Windows, macOS, and Linux (full GUI, not just a CLI script), plus router firmware and Fire TV builds, so coverage parity is a wash; the cap is the only thing that actually changes day-to-day.
